I'm not going to lie to you. Any song feature The-Dream saying "motherf**king" in the first ten seconds is guaranteed a listen from yours truly (I'm a classy dude), and that's exactly the situation facing us today with Mariah Carey's "Ribbon (Remix)", a new take on her "Memoirs of an Imperfect Angel" slow jam that also brings on Ludacris for a romantic, complete opposite of "Hey Ho" verse. Ultimately though, it's The-Dream's always catchy vocals that overshadow both Luda's rhymes and Mariah's soprano vocals. What can I say? The-Dream is the motherfu**king sh*t. Told you I was classy .

It just occurred to me that as a music lover my nightmare is a Nick Cannon+Mariah Carey duet, but as a writer it's my dream. The comic potential would be off the charts.

Oh, yeah. The track is off Mariah's remix album "Angels Advocate", set to drop March 30. "Angels Advocate" doesn't have any official art work yet, so I went with this old school pic. Any objections? I thought not.
